1. Royal Golf de Marrakech
Located west of the city center and near the medina, stretching along Avenue Mohammed VI, this golf course offers a panoramic view of the Atlas Mountains. This prime location allows golfers to enjoy a beautiful setting easily accessible from the heart of the city. The iconic Royal Golf offers two 18-hole courses, creating a diverse challenge for players. The narrow fairways and undulating greens highlight short game skills. With a historic atmosphere and refined facilities, it’s a must-visit for golf enthusiasts.
2. Palmeraie Golf Palace
Located north of the medina in the Palmeraie district that bears its name, this course extends within the Palmeraie Golf Palace hotel complex. One of its main assets: its picturesque views of the verdant landscapes of the Palmeraie. Golfers will also enjoy a peaceful and lush environment. This sumptuous complex, born from the imagination of architect Robert Trent Jones Senior, offers an 18-hole course. The 11 lakes and numerous bunkers make it a strategic challenge. Luxury services, an elegant clubhouse, and a panoramic view of the Atlas Mountains enhance the experience.
3. Assoufid Golf Club
This other golf course southwest of the historic medina is one of the largest in Morocco, covering an area of over 70 hectares. It is part of a resort of the same name, also enjoying the panorama of the Atlas Mountains. Designed by renowned Scottish architect Niall Cameron, this 18-hole course subtly blends desert and mountains. The fairways are lined with stones, palm trees, and cacti, offering a unique challenge. In addition to an impressive view of the mountains that make it an exceptional place, this golf course offers a modern clubhouse.
4. Al Maaden Golf
Still close to the Palmeraie district, this golf course extends into the residential complex named Al Maaden designed by Kyle Philips, a modern golf architect. It is also easily accessible being a short drive from the center of Marrakech. It offers an 18-hole Links-style course, featuring undulating fairways and strategically placed bunkers, providing good challenges for golfers of all levels. With the Atlas Mountains in the background, Al Maaden Golf offers a spectacular environment.
5. Samana Golf Avenue
This golf course also extends along Avenue Mohamed VI in the heart of the Palmeraie district. It also offers a serene oasis environment with palm trees and olive trees lining the fairways. The proximity to the amenities of the city of Marrakech is also one of its main assets. Samana Golf Avenue features a 9-hole course, ideal for a quick game and for amateur profiles. But despite its size, it offers varied challenges for golfers of all levels.

Top 10 activities to do in Marrakech
Between two rounds of golf, you are invited to indulge in other equally memorable activities in Marrakech and its surroundings. Here are a few more ideas!
- Take a camel ride within the Palmeraie of Marrakech
- Stroll in the Jemaa el-Fna square: during the day, in a colorful market where spice stalls, handicrafts, and culinary delights intermingle, and in the evening, in front of a vast captivating entertainment venue with storytellers, musicians, snake charmers…
- Relax at the lush Majorelle Garden, with its shaded paths, exotic plants, and famous cobalt blue
- Visit the medina and the city’s souks
- Cross the dunes and discover the starry sky of the Zagora desert
- Explore the Bahia Palace and immerse yourself in the opulence and grandeur of Moroccan history
- Discover the Marrakech Museum and the glorious past of the Pearl of the South through its elegant rooms
- Conquer the Atlas Mountains
- Cool off at the Oasiria water park where you can escape the dazzling heat of Marrakech
- Relax in a local hammam and enjoy a delicious mint tea.
